What is the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form?
The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form is a critical document designed to collect essential medical history and patient information. This form is particularly important for patients as it enables them to systematically gather and submit their medical history to healthcare providers. The form typically includes personal details and comprehensive medical history, ensuring that healthcare professionals have the necessary background to provide effective care.
Completing this medical intake form is vital for fostering accurate communication between patients and providers, thus facilitating better healthcare outcomes.

Who is eligible to fill out the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form?
The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form is intended for patients seeking healthcare services. It may also be used by their legal representatives or guardians when necessary.
Is there a deadline for submitting this medical form?
While there typically isn't a formal deadline, it is advisable to submit the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form as soon as possible, especially before scheduled medical appointments, to avoid delays in receiving care.
What methods are available for submitting the completed form?
You can submit the completed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form electronically via email if required by your healthcare provider, or print and deliver it in person. Check with your provider for specific submission guidelines.
Are there any required supporting documents I need to provide with this form?
Generally, no additional documents are required with the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form unless specified by your healthcare provider. Ensure that you inquire about such requirements before submission.
What common mistakes should I avoid when completing this form?
Common mistakes include providing incomplete information, failing to sign the form, and not reviewing entries for accuracy. Always double-check all responses and ensure your signature is present before submission.
How long does it take to process the Health Consumer Alliance Medical Form after submission?
Processing times may vary by healthcare provider. Typically, the form is reviewed shortly after submission, and patients may be contacted within a few days for any follow-up information if needed.
